Abstract: We propose a graphical method to treat dilution shift in NMR spectra to determine the monomer shift, dimer shift and dimerization constant simultaneously and consistently for the system of monomer/dimer equilibrium. The salient features include avoiding error-prone manual extrapolation to zero concentration to obtain a monomer shift, and providing consistent assessment and error estimation for the determination. The dilution shifts of 2-isopropyl phenol in C6D12 serve to demonstrate this graphical method. The enthalpy and entropy of dimerization are determined via a van't Hoff plot from the temperature variation of the dimerization constant.
